Cleaning
The oven is a very important appliance in the kitchen. But it's also one of the most difficult to keep clean. A distinct odour and an extensive layer of crud are all indications that it's time to clean your oven. Cleaning your oven regularly can prevent build-up and help reduce the time needed for complete cleaning. Some models have self-cleaning functions that removes grease and dirt. This makes the task even easier.
Clean your oven's interior surfaces after each use to prevent food residues from building up. Wipe inside the glass door to avoid the formation of smudges. Also, you should regularly wipe stainless steel oven components including handles and knobs - with an abrasive cloth that has been immersed in soapy water and warm water. This will get rid of any grease or dirt that is loose before it gets stuck.
There are cleaning products that can get rid of tough stains, but they may be harsh. It is recommended to stick with the traditional method of wiping. If you do need an extensive clean, make sure to adhere to the manufacturer's cleaning instructions for the specific oven model.
You can also experiment with an alternative that is natural and cost-effective to chemical cleaners by coating the interior of your oven with a paste that is made from bicarbonate of soda and water. Baking soda is an abrasive that helps break down the hardened crud. The warm water and vinegar eliminate it. Before you begin this process remove all racks, oven thermometers and pans. Also, ensure that the oven's vents aren't blocked as air must be able to circulate freely to maintain the best performance.
Additionally, some models come with an AquaLift cycle that produces hot steam to release food residue and make it easy to clean. However, it is important to be cautious not to burn yourself or damage your oven with high temperatures, and a steamer that is hot is only suitable for occasional, light cleaning jobs.
